Ingredients

• 6 eggs
• 4 tbsp milk
• pinch of cinnamon
• 2 tablespoons butter
• 6-8 slices of toast bread

Steps for making the perfect eggs and toast

  1. Mix 6 eggs and 4 tablespoons of milk in a bowl with a pinch of cinnamon. Mix well.
  2. Cut 6 to 8 thick toast slices of bread – these can then be cut into halves or triangles if you wish. Heat a little butter in a non-stick frypan over a medium heat.
  3. Dip bread one piece at a time into the egg mixture. Coat both sides well.
  4. Put coated bread into a fry pan and cook for 2 to 3 minutes on each side, or until golden.
  5. You should be able to cook 2–4 pieces at a time depending on the size of your pan.
  6. Repeat with remaining slices of bread (add a little more butter if needed between batches).
  7. Serve warm with any of the serving options listed below or your own creations.

SERVING IDEAS Yoghurt honey, maple syrup, blueberries, bananas, peaches, strawberries, bacon…
